12410343
0xa0bcf621cb4278eb9a7077184e9b6c131f6232778a356428a78b6ec415451861
Transactions0
Height12410343
Confirmations1973168
Timestamp166 days 19 hours ago
Size (bytes)1011
Version
Merkle Root
Nonce0xb40e38228792738c
Bits
Difficulty0x278e45e4